If u upgrade ur T68m to 'i' on orange and its faulty/lost/stolen pissed on - whatever - u will get a T68m back again - unless they withdraw the 'm' altogether (probably once all new stock is gone) - but they will have loads of recon 'm' phones for insurance/faulty replacements anyway - so yeh - you'll have to take it in/send it off (like me) for the software update - and mentioned earlier they may refuse to replace the handset if one comes back in with different software version than expected (the insurance dept can refuse replacements & then charge u 4a new h/set or ask for the hset to be returned for testing first - it's in ur T&C's)
